Former minister Khader denounces ‘Lashkar’ graffiti, demands probe

Mangaluru, 30 Nov 2020 [Fik/News Sources]: Ullal MLA and former state minister U T Khader on Sunday November 29 came down heavily on the acts of vandalism by miscreants who posted provocative graffiti in some parts of the city. Speaking to reporters at the Circuit House today, Khader said he strongly condemned the act and demanded immediate action from police to apprehend the culprits.

It may be recalled that a provocative message in support of terrorist outfits like Laskar E Toiba and Taliban had been posted on the wall of an apartment complex in Bejai. The message is suspected to have been painted on Thursday night and was noticed by passersby only on Friday morning. Subsequently yet another graffiti was discovered on Sunday morning at the District Court Complex. In both incidences, police rushed to the spot immediately and erased the messages. 

Expressing his concern over the matter, Khader said, “I strongly condemn this wicked act of posting provocative graffiti. Such activities cannot be tolerated. Whoever is responsible should not be spared. It is the responsibility of BJP government and the police department to nab the culprits.”

He further alleged that when BJP is in power, anti-social elements get empowered. “Incidents like wall graffiti never happened during Congress regime. Under BJP, terrorist sympathizers are raising their head. There is utter lawlessness in the district and people are not afraid of police. What is the intelligence department doing? I demand that the culprits should be caught within a week. We shall wait for maximum 15 days. If police fail to nab the culprits, we shall launch an agitation,” he said.
